Rome2Rio

How to get fromMumbai to Champaranby plane, train, bus, taxi or car

Find Transport to Champaran

See all options

There are 11 ways to get from Mumbai to Champaran by plane, train, bus, taxi, or car

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.

  1. Fly to Lok Nayak Jayaprakash Airport, train

    best
    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Lok Nayak Jayaprakash Airport (PAT)plane plane BOM - PAT
    2. Take the train from Patliputra to Majhowaliatrain train
    10h 6m
    ₹7,767–21,392
  2. Train

    cheapest
    1. Take the train from Lokmanyatilak to Sagauli Jntrain train 15268
    39h 20m
    ₹1,307–6,658
  3. Bus, train, taxi

    1. Take the bus from Dadar East to Pune Swargatebus bus
    2. Take the bus from Pune to Nashik CBSbus bus
    3. Take the bus from Nashik Dwarka to Gorakhpur Nausadbus bus
    4. Take the train from Gorakhpur to Deoria Sadartrain train
    5. Take the taxi from Deoria Sadar to Champarantaxi taxi
    26h 21m
    ₹7,987–10,372
  4. Drive 1,787.2 km

    1. Drive from Mumbai to Champarancar car 1,787.2 km
    23h 26m
    ₹19,156–27,669
  5. Fly to Gorakhpur Airport, train

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Gorakhpur Airport (GOP)plane plane BOM - GOP
    2. Take the train from Gorakhpur to Sagauli Jntrain train
    9h 30m
    ₹8,047–19,762
  6. Fly to Darbhanga Airport, train

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Darbhanga Airport (DBR)plane plane BOM - DBR
    2. Take the train from Darbhanga Jn to Sagauli Jntrain train
    10h 24m
    ₹6,417–20,612
  7. Fly to Tribhuvan International Airport, drive

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Tribhuvan International Airport (KTM)plane plane BOM - KTM
    2. Drive from Tribhuvan International Airport (KTM) to Champarancar car
    7h 52m
    ₹8,917–21,182
  8. Fly to Maryada Purushottam Shri Ram International Airport, train

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Maryada Purushottam Shri Ram International Airport (AYJ)plane plane BOM - AYJ
    2. Take the train from Ayodhya to Siktatrain train
    11h 49m
    ₹10,397–20,332
  9. Fly to Simara Airport, drive

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Simara Airport (SIF)plane plane BOM - SIF
    2. Drive from Simara Airport (SIF) to Champarancar car
    8h 23m
    ₹8,117–26,182
  10. Fly to Varanasi Airport, train

    1. Fly from Chhatrapati Shivaji Maharaj International Airport (BOM) to Varanasi Airport (VNS)plane plane BOM - VNS
    2. Take the train from Banaras to Sagauli Jntrain train
    14h 7m
    ₹7,287–18,682
  11. Train via Andheri

    1. Take the train from Andheri to Sagauli Jntrain train 19037
    44h 33m
    ₹1,356–7,212

Chhatrapati Shivaji Maharaj International Airport (BOM) to Lok Nayak Jayaprakash Airport (PAT) flights

Calendar104Weekly Planes
Duration4h 13mAverage Duration
Ticket₹6,967Cheapest Price
See schedules

Questions & Answers

What companies run services between Mumbai, India and Champaran, State of Bihar, India?

Indian Railways operates a train from Lokmanyatilak to Sagauli Jn once a week. Tickets cost ₹800–6,000 and the journey takes 37h 25m.

Airlines
Train operators
Bus operators
Other operators

Want to know more about travelling around the world?

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Travelling Croatia’s Dalmatian Coast by boat, bus, car and train, Which side of Niagara Falls should I choose (and how do I get there)?, and Bali: What to do if Mount Agung erupts - to help you get the most out of your next trip.